- Keyword Research: The cornerstone of any SEO strategy. Find out what people are searching for.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, or Ahrefs to identify relevant keywords with high search volume and low competition. Focus on terms that your target audience uses. Keywords need to be incorporated strategically.
- Content Creation: Create high-quality, engaging content that answers your audience's questions and provides value. This could be blog posts, articles, videos, infographics, or anything else that resonates with your audience. The content should be original and well-written and optimized for your chosen keywords.
- Title Tags and Meta Descriptions: These are the first things people see in search results. Make them compelling and include your target keywords to encourage clicks. The title tags should be descriptive and the meta descriptions should provide a brief summary of the page.
- Header Tags (H1-H6): Structure your content with header tags to make it easy to read and understand for both users and search engines. Use H1 for your main title, H2 for subheadings, and so on. Header tags tell search engines what your content is about.
- Image Optimization: Optimize your images by using descriptive file names, alt text, and compressing them to improve loading speed. Use alt tags. This helps search engines understand what the images are about and can improve your SEO.
- Internal Linking: Link to other relevant pages on your website to improve navigation and distribute link juice. This creates a web of interconnected content, which helps search engines understand the relationships between pages.
- Backlink Building: Obtain links from other reputable websites. This is a crucial ranking factor. It shows search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y. Link building is the process of getting other websites to link to your content. Get links from authoritative sites.
- Social Media Marketing: Use social media to promote your content and engage with your audience. Share your content. Increase brand visibility. This can drive traffic and improve your search engine rankings.
- Online Reputation Management: Monitor and manage your online reputation. This can positively impact your search engine rankings and business. Address any negative reviews promptly and professionally.
- Guest Blogging: Write guest posts for other websites to reach a new audience and gain backlinks. This helps establish you as an expert. This also lets you drive referral traffic.
- Website Speed: Make sure your website loads quickly. Use tools like Google PageSpeed Insights to identify and fix any speed issues. Fast websites provide a better user experience.
- Mobile-Friendliness: Ensure your website is responsive and looks good on all devices. Mobile-first indexing is now the norm, which means Google prioritizes mobile-friendly websites.
- Website Structure: Organize your website in a clear and logical way, making it easy for both users and search engines to navigate. Website structure involves designing your website in an organized manner.
- XML Sitemap: Submit an XML sitemap to search engines to help them crawl your website more efficiently. This provides a map of your website's content.
- Robots.txt: Use a robots.txt file to instruct search engines which pages to crawl and which to ignore. This can help prevent the indexing of irrelevant pages.
- SSL Certificate: Secure your website with an SSL certificate to ensure a secure connection. This is important for user trust and can also improve search engine rankings.

What Exactly is SEO and Why Does It Matter?
So, what's all the fuss about SEO, anyway? Well, SEO stands for Search Engine Optimization, and it's all about making your website more visible on search engines like Google, Bing, and Yahoo. When someone searches for something, these search engines use complex algorithms to determine which websites are the most relevant and valuable. The higher your website ranks, the more likely people are to click on it. It is like digital real estate: the higher the ranking, the better the view. Think of it like this: If your website is buried on page 10 of Google, it's virtually invisible. No one scrolls that far! SEO helps you get on the first page, where the magic happens. SEO focuses on both on-page and off-page optimization to improve search engine rankings. It's important to understand the basics of SEO.

Keyword Research: The Foundation of Your Strategy
Keyword research is the foundation upon which you build your SEO strategy. It's the process of finding the terms and phrases your target audience uses when searching for information related to your business. This is the first step in SEO, and doing it right can save you a lot of time and effort. This allows you to speak the language of your audience. Keyword research isn't just about finding any keywords; it's about finding the right keywords. These are the keywords that your target audience uses. To select the right keywords, it's essential to understand your audience and what they're looking for.
Think about what problems they have and what solutions they are seeking. This is where keyword research comes into play. Keywords that are highly searched but also have low competition are the most valuable. High search volume means more potential traffic, while low competition means your chances of ranking are higher. You can use various tools for keyword research. Google Keyword Planner is a great starting point, but other tools like SEMrush, Ahrefs, and Moz Keyword Explorer offer more advanced features and insights. These tools will provide data on search volume, keyword difficulty, and related terms. This can help you refine your strategy.
Once you have a list of keywords, it's important to categorize them. This will make it easier to organize your content. The most common way to categorize keywords is by intent. There are usually three main types of search intent: informational, navigational, and transactional. Informational keywords are used when someone is looking for information. Navigational keywords are used when someone is looking for a specific website. Transactional keywords are used when someone is ready to make a purchase. By understanding search intent, you can tailor your content to match what users are looking for. This will increase the chances of getting clicks, conversions, and all-around success.
Once you’ve identified your keywords, incorporate them naturally throughout your content. Don’t stuff keywords. Keyword stuffing can harm your rankings. Use them in your title tags, meta descriptions, header tags, and body content. However, always prioritize readability and user experience. The goal is to provide value to your audience. This can improve your search engine rankings and increase user engagement. This process is constantly evolving. It is important to continually revisit your keyword strategy. Analyzing your search engine rankings and traffic can tell you what’s working and what isn’t. Be ready to adapt your strategy as trends change. The right keywords are essential to SEO success.

Building Backlinks: The Key to Online Authority
Backlink building is a crucial part of SEO. It’s the process of getting other websites to link back to yours. Think of backlinks as votes of confidence from other websites. The more high-quality backlinks you have, the more authoritative your website appears. Search engines use backlinks to determine the value and relevance of your website. Backlinks are an important ranking factor. This is because they signal to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.
Building backlinks requires effort. This means reaching out to other websites and asking them to link to your content. There are different strategies for this. One of the most effective is creating high-quality content that people want to share and link to. This could be in the form of original research, detailed guides, or unique insights. Content marketing and link building go hand in hand. Another effective strategy is guest blogging. This involves writing articles for other websites. This gives you the opportunity to reach a new audience and get a backlink to your website. Guest blogging can be a win-win situation.
Another approach is broken link building. This involves finding broken links on other websites and offering your content as a replacement. This is a very effective strategy. Other methods include creating infographics. Infographics are very shareable. You can also participate in online communities and forums. This provides an opportunity to share your expertise and earn links.
Quality is very important. Not all backlinks are created equal. Focus on getting backlinks from authoritative websites. These are websites that have a high domain authority and are well-respected in your industry. Backlinks from low-quality or spammy websites can actually hurt your SEO. It is important to regularly monitor your backlinks. This is important to ensure that you are not losing any important links. There are various tools available to help you with this. Backlink building is a long-term strategy. It takes time and effort to build a strong backlink profile. This is very important to online authority.
Technical SEO: Ensuring Your Website is Search Engine Friendly
Technical SEO focuses on the behind-the-scenes aspects of your website. This ensures that it is easy for search engines to crawl, index, and understand. This makes sure that your website is technically sound. It also increases your chances of ranking higher. Technical SEO is all about optimizing the technical aspects of your website. This can include website speed, mobile-friendliness, website structure, and more. Without a solid technical foundation, your SEO efforts may not be as effective.
One of the most important aspects is website speed. This includes making sure that your website loads quickly. Slow-loading websites can frustrate users and negatively impact your search engine rankings. You can optimize your website speed. This includes compressing images. Use a content delivery network (CDN). Make sure that your website is mobile-friendly. A mobile-friendly website provides a good experience. Search engines favor websites that are responsive and look good on all devices. You can use Google’s mobile-friendly test tool. This will help you identify any issues.
Another important aspect is website structure. This refers to the way that your website is organized and how content is linked together. A well-structured website is easy to navigate. Ensure that search engines can easily crawl and index all your content. You can create an XML sitemap. A sitemap is a map of your website. This provides an easy way for search engines to discover all your pages. You can also create a robots.txt file. Use this file to instruct search engines which pages to crawl and which to ignore. This can help you manage your website’s crawl budget.
Tracking and Analyzing Your SEO Efforts
Tracking and analyzing your SEO efforts is essential to understand what's working and what needs improvement. This helps you monitor your progress. This process will help you refine your strategy. You can use a variety of tools to track your SEO performance. Some popular tools include Google Analytics, Google Search Console, SEMrush, and Ahrefs. These tools provide valuable insights into your website's traffic, rankings, and other key metrics.
Google Analytics is a powerful tool for tracking your website traffic. You can see how many people visit your website, where they come from, and what they do on your site. This will give you a better understanding of your audience. Google Search Console is a free tool provided by Google. It provides valuable information about your website’s performance in search results. You can see which keywords you rank for, how often your website appears in search results, and any technical issues that need to be addressed.
SEMrush and Ahrefs are comprehensive SEO tools that offer more advanced features. This includes keyword research, backlink analysis, and competitor analysis. These tools can help you identify opportunities to improve your SEO. Once you start tracking your SEO efforts, you will want to analyze the data. This involves looking at the trends and patterns in your data. It is important to know which keywords are driving the most traffic and which pages are performing the best. This will help you focus your efforts on the most effective strategies. Regularly review and analyze your SEO data. Be prepared to make adjustments. It is important to test and experiment with different strategies. SEO is an ongoing process. You must track and analyze your efforts to improve your rankings and drive more organic traffic.
